B.P. Koirala Memorial Cancer Hospital is a tertiary cancer hospital located outside the Kathmandu valley in Bharatpur, Chitwan District, Nepal. The hospital is named in honor of Bishweshwar Prasad Koirala, the first democratically elected Prime Minister of Nepal who died of throat cancer in 1982. Derived from Wikipedia licensed CC-BY-SA.
